File allocation using I nodes.
This method is used to decrease the size of the table in the above method. Every file will have an I-node list. Allow a file have 15 pointers after that the first 12 pointers can be used to point to the blocks directly. The next three pointers are able to be used to point to indirect blocks. The first two point toward single indirect blocks. The single indirect block is an index box containing not data other than the addresses of blocks that contain data and the last pointer points to a double indirect block which contains the addresses of blocks that contain pointers to the actual data blocks.
